i have a C-pig in a ibanez RG2570
[ BASSWOOD body , maple neck ] TUNING : C#
but... the suond dont comes out from my amp ( 5150 peavey)!!!!!!!!!!
my sound with this guitar is dark and stifled... i've tried to put a 1 meg volume pot, but the sound is almost the same.
i've tried to put some capacitors between the Hot of the bkp and the pot, but the sound has changed very few.
i've tried to lower the pickup from the strings for cut the bass freq but the distortion isn't the same...
what can i do to have a sound more open ?
i tell you this because i hear the difference when i play this my ibanez and my cort custom shop with a calibrated set of Painkiller and because all my friends tell me after a live performance that there is much difference between this two guitars!
help! :)

All three Ibanez guitars I have are all quite dark sounding guitars. The only thing I can think of that you havent said youve done is raise the screwpoles nearest the bridge a bit and lower the neck sid screwpoles and that should brighten up your sound.
-
try wiring it straight to the jack and see how she goes :P. I had a C-pig in a basswood with maple neck-thru guitar and i thought it was too dark even though it was maple neck thru.
